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
870 0498156321 4692 20886874 163828815
46923 74 289108697
46923 74 289108697
6889 81633452 28
All about undefined
Interested in learning more?
46923 74 289108697
6889 81633452 28
See more
026 6498637834
59100 1580 66 0946790
See more
588549875 031551
528 1605587732 0176089965 027849 862339
See more